Transaction 908a9ea95e39a9ad4d635e5d84e8ad788ab056729e32b7f529c3d9f12085775b

5 Input
1 Outputs
  • 908a9ea95e39a9ad4d635e5d84e8ad788ab056729e32b7f529c3d9f12085775b:0
  • value  17050511
    address  146AJ7xjkUGxoyGN6M9NpYn1eJWTLPHnyX